TIME WARP: THE TEMPORAL ENCHANTMENT
Overview
Tired of losing all your progress to a Creeper explosion, lava, or a sudden fall into the void?
Time Warp introduces a powerful enchantment that grants you a second chance at life by literally rewinding time when you would normally die.
Key Feature: Temporal Resilience
The Time Warp enchantment acts as a powerful “insurance policy” against death.
If you are wearing a full set of Time Warp enchanted armor and take fatal damage, the enchantment automatically activates and rewinds your state instead of letting you die.
How It Works
- The mod continuously records a snapshot of the player state (every 5 ticks / ~4 times per second)
- When fatal damage occurs, the system triggers a rewind
- The player is restored to a previous safe state (default: seconds before death)
Restored data:
- Health & hunger
- Position
- Full inventory & armor
- Experience (XP)
- Selected hotbar slot
To prevent duplication exploits, dropped items within the rewind window are removed automatically.
How to Get the Enchantment
Time Warp is a rare and powerful enchantment:
- Enchanting Table (very rare)
- Treasure loot (Dungeons, Mineshafts, Strongholds, etc.)
- Villager trading (Expert Librarians)
- Anvil application via enchanted book
Visual & Gameplay Feedback
- Portal / enchant particles when ability is ready
- Sound effects (Enderman teleport, bell, amethyst chime)
- Action bar + chat feedback on activation
- Full server-side synced effects (no desync issues)
Cooldown System
After activation, Time Warp enters a cooldown phase:
- Standard cooldown: 5 minutes
- Visual boss bar countdown (v2+)
- Clear start/end messages
Extra Features
Scarlet Equipment (v2+)
- New weapon: Scarlet Blade (13 damage, 1.0 attack speed)
- Full Scarlet armor set bonus abilities
- Synergy effects with Time Warp rewind (buffed regeneration, resistance, absorption, etc.)
Area Ability (Z Key) (temporarily disabled)
- Applies AoE Slowness to nearby mobs (~5 blocks).
- Includes visual particle ring and sound feedback.
- 30s cooldown (server-side enforced).
Currently temporarily disabled due to a known bug. It will be re-enabled in a future update.
Recall Ability (J Key)
- Teleports player to spawn / bed / respawn anchor
- Requires full armor + Space enchant requirement
- Shared balancing rules with Time Warp system
Configuration & Compatibility
- Fully server-compatible (uses ServerPlayer / ServerLevel systems)
- Works in singleplayer and multiplayer
- Highly configurable (cooldowns, XP cost, rewind duration, drop radius, etc.)
- No external dependencies (except required libraries in latest versions like PlayerAnimator if used)
Possible incompatibility with mods that heavily modify death mechanics (e.g. grave systems, keep inventory).
